- Lead teachers are licensed and degreed with experience.
- The Director has over 10 years of preschool and special education experience; and is the Intervention Specialist.
- Small classes of 12 students with 2 teachers to increase individual attention
- Spanish classes with themes that correlate to our classroom themes
- Physical education classes provided by Stretch-n-Grow
- A monthly theme-based academic learning curriculum by Mother Goose Time designed to prepare students for Kindergarten
- Curriculum aligned with Ohio early learning content standards
- Exposure to a variety of art activities, play concepts, and music genres.
- Socialization skills: learning how to play and interact with others
- Inclusive learning environment designed to meet the needs of ALL children of ALL abilities taught by an Intervention Specialist
- Inclusive ratio of 8 typical to 4 non-typical
- Structured educational classroom setting
- All snacks and meals are provided by parents which encourage healthy eating and prevent allergy issues (we are a nut and peanut-free school)
- Kindergarten readiness preparation in science, math, language, literacy, and social studies.
- We follow a traditional school year from September to June.
- We follow the South Euclid-Lyndhurst school district for inclement weather days
- All children, except those enrolled in Mommy and Me classes, must be fully potty trained to attend the center.
- Enrollment for the following year starts in January and will continue as long as there is space.
